ORDER

PER CURIAM :

AND NOW, this 5th day of June, 2013, Michael T. Brown having been indefinitely suspended from the practice of law in the State of Maryland by Order of the Court of Appeals of Maryland dated December 12, 2012; the said Michael T. Brown having been directed on April 16, 2013, to inform this Court of any claim he has that the imposition of the identical or comparable discipline in this Commonwealth would be unwarranted and the reasons therefor; and no response having been filed, it is

ORDERED that Michael T. Brown is suspended from the practice of law in this Commonwealth consistent with the Order of the Court of Appeals of Maryland dated December 12, 2012, and he shall comply with all the provisions of Rule 217, Pa.R.D.E.
